Doughty’s ballot for the Oct. 14 AP top 25 poll

1. Alabama

2. Oregon

3. Florida

4. Notre Dame

5. Ohio State

6. Kansas State

7. Ore. State

8. Miss. State

9. LSU

10. Oklahoma

11. South Carolina

12 Florida State

13 Southern Cal

14. Louisville

15. Clemson

16. Georgia

17. Texas Tech

18. West Virginia

19. Rutgers

20. Cincinnati

21. Texas A&M

22. Ohio U.

23, Ariz. State

24. North Carolina

25. Stanford
